https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=695545 --- Comment #4 from Jeff Fearn <jfe...@redhat.com> 2011-04-18 22:23:27 EDT --- It occurs to me that the biggest question here is what OS is this intended for? If the target is RHEL 4/5 then we need to be able to add the entire Publican stack in to a brew root for those OS's. If the target is RHEL 6 then we will need to be able to update the version of Publican in RHEL 6, or add the entire Publican stack in to another brew root where we can ship an updated Publican. The reason for this is that the web site packages require Publican on the system they are being installed on to. Perhaps a better option would be to allow the desktop packages to switch formats. e.g. instead of it containing html-desktop it could contain the eclipse output, or HTML chunked, instead.
